Replacing the Processor Extender Board

To replace the processor extender board, perform the following steps:
CAUTION
Your processor extender board may be used in either Itanium (IPF) or PA RISC processor based
systems. Ensure that the PA RISC/IPF dipswitch is set to PA RISC for proper functioning of
your system. See Figure 4-13 on page 55 for the correct dipswitch settings.
Step 1. Ensure the extraction levers are positioned in the outward, unlocked position.
Step 2. Align the processor extender board with the front and rear card guides.
Step 3. Slide the processor extender board down until it begins to seat in the socket located on the
midplane riser board.
Step 4. Push the extraction levers inward to the locked position in order to fully seat the processor extender
board into the socket on the midplane riser board.
Step 5. Replace the front cover.
Step 6. Replace the front bezel.
Step 7. If rack mounted, slide the HP Server into the rack until it stops.
